Filter

    Shop All Tops & Blouses

    536 products
    Sale
    Frank Lyman Top 231734U
    Frank Lyman
    Regular price £143.00 GBP Sale price£100.10 GBP Save 30%
    Sale
    Joseph Ribkoff Top 222073
    Joseph Ribkoff
    Regular price £175.00 GBP Sale price£122.50 GBP Save 30%
    Sold Out
    Joseph Ribkoff Tunic 231299
    Joseph Ribkoff
    Regular price £189.00 GBP Sale price£113.40 GBP Save 40%
    Sale
    Frank Lyman Top 236670U
    Frank Lyman
    Regular price £138.00 GBP Sale price£96.60 GBP Save 30%
    Sale
    Joseph Ribkoff Top 231234
    Joseph Ribkoff
    Regular price £189.00 GBP Sale price£113.40 GBP Save 40%
    Sale
    Joseph Ribkoff Top 234083
    Joseph Ribkoff
    Regular price £199.00 GBP Sale price£99.50 GBP Save 50%
    New
    Joseph Ribkoff Top 242108
    Joseph Ribkoff
    £135.00 GBP
    Sale
    Joseph Ribkoff Top 231209
    Joseph Ribkoff
    Regular price £169.00 GBP Sale price£101.40 GBP Save 40%
    Sale
    Joseph Ribkoff Top 231941
    Joseph Ribkoff
    Regular price £125.00 GBP Sale price£81.25 GBP Save 35%
    Sale
    Joseph Ribkoff Top 221234
    Joseph Ribkoff
    Regular price £165.00 GBP Sale price£115.50 GBP Save 30%
    Sale
    Frank Lyman Top 223773
    Frank Lyman
    Regular price £124.00 GBP Sale price£86.80 GBP Save 30%
    Sale
    Frank Lyman Top 223508
    Frank Lyman
    Regular price £124.00 GBP Sale price£86.80 GBP Save 30%
    Clearance
    Joseph Ribkoff Tunic 202362
    Joseph Ribkoff
    Regular price £255.00 GBP Sale price£99.00 GBP Save 61%
    Clearance
    Joseph Ribkoff Top 201534
    Joseph Ribkoff
    Regular price £155.00 GBP Sale price£99.00 GBP Save 36%
    Clearance
    Joseph Ribkoff Top 201507
    Joseph Ribkoff
    Regular price £165.00 GBP Sale price£99.00 GBP Save 40%
    Clearance
    Joseph Ribkoff Top 201155
    Joseph Ribkoff
    Regular price £175.00 GBP Sale price£99.00 GBP Save 43%
    Clearance
    Joseph Ribkoff 2 Piece Top 214180
    Joseph Ribkoff
    Regular price £265.00 GBP Sale price£99.00 GBP Save 63%
    Sale
    Joseph Ribkoff Top 232024
    Joseph Ribkoff
    Regular price £175.00 GBP Sale price£105.00 GBP Save 40%
    Sale
    Frank Lyman Top 224153
    Frank Lyman
    Regular price £119.00 GBP Sale price£83.30 GBP Save 30%
    Sale
    Dolcezza Top 73111
    Dolcezza
    Regular price £157.00 GBP Sale price£94.00 GBP Save 40%
    Sale
    Joseph Ribkoff Tunic 223053
    Joseph Ribkoff
    Regular price £209.00 GBP Sale price£104.50 GBP Save 50%
    Sale
    Frank Lyman Top 223541
    Frank Lyman
    Regular price £116.00 GBP Sale price£81.20 GBP Save 30%
    Sale
    Frank Lyman Top 226106U
    Frank Lyman
    Regular price £125.00 GBP Sale price£87.50 GBP Save 30%
    Sale
    Joseph Ribkoff Top 231291
    Joseph Ribkoff
    Regular price £155.00 GBP Sale price£100.75 GBP Save 35%
    Sale
    Frank Lyman Top 221102U
    Frank Lyman
    Regular price £119.00 GBP Sale price£83.30 GBP Save 30%
    Sale
    Joseph Ribkoff Tunic 231158
    Joseph Ribkoff
    Regular price £155.00 GBP Sale price£100.75 GBP Save 35%
    Sale
    Joseph Ribkoff Top 232908
    Joseph Ribkoff
    Regular price £125.00 GBP Sale price£75.00 GBP Save 40%
    Sale
    Dolcezza Pullover 72611
    Dolcezza
    Regular price £124.00 GBP Sale price£86.80 GBP Save 30%